Country Manager

Our Client is operating a digital sportsbook license in South Africa under the Western Cape Gambling Board and we are looking to recruit an experienced ambitious and energetic Country Manager to drive growth in the South African market.

As the Country Manager your primary objective is to develop and execute strategic plans to maximise revenue market share and profitability while ensuring compliance with local regulations and maintaining a positive brand reputation. Ultimately you will lead and coordinate various aspects of the South African operation.

The Country Manager South Africa will be responsible for working with the local management team and our clients external technology partners as well as our management team within our clients organisation. You will represent our client in the jurisdiction taking full regulatory marketing operational and P&L responsibility for the South African business.

Location: Hybrid / Remote Cape Town

Reporting To: Chief Commercial Officer

Responsibilities:

  • Full P & L responsibility for the entire South African digital business including regular communication and reporting on business performance against target KPIs.
  • Reporting to the Chief Commercial Officer you will manage and be responsible for all daytoday activities of the digital business
  • Working closely with the existing management team in Ireland and Gibraltar to develop the strategic direction of the business and execute it successfully.
  • Define and implement detailed marketing plans to target the South African market and take ownership of the acquisition marketing strategy and business performance for SA across core product verticals: sportsbook and casino.
  • Overall responsibility for customer experience service levels and satisfaction in the market and the direction for local product development.
  • Liaising positively with external parties that are central to and underpin the business in the jurisdiction using communication skills to get the best from the relationship.
  • Work closely with the Business Intelligence function to analyse business performance and proactively react to results.
  • Communicate as needed to key departments within the business or partners that provide these departmental activities Customer Service Compliance Marketing Content Design Product and Payments departments.
  • Develop and execute campaign plan including campaign briefing defining customer target segments brainstorming with writers and designers and signing off assets and marketing material.
  • Maintain brand integrity for the company and protect this across all channels of operation as well as driving the brand campaign planning process contributing with campaign ideas marketing briefs and campaign review deliverables with the South African market.
  • Drive the product and content localisation to ensure suitability for the local marketplace and to maximise the positive impact with customers.
  • Act decisively but collaboratively on critical business issues and communicate those decisions clearly to all stakeholders and execute.
  • In conjunction with relevant stakeholders take responsibility for and ensure adherence to all regulatory and governance responsibilities across all jurisdictions for all business components.
  • Maintain strong knowledge of the SA market making recommendations to the business to ensure the establishment of the business in the geo and the roadmap towards the implementation of a marketleading proposition.
  • Where relevant represent our Client at regulatory meetings external partner gatherings and relevant trade shows.

Management of Team

  • Manage supervise and direct internal and external teams and resources.
  • Develop the local team with regard to performance appraisal and team development.
  • Build and lead a highperforming team providing clear direction guidance and support to achieve business objectives.
  • Foster a positive and collaborative work environment to motivate and retain talent.

Requirements:

    • A keen knowledge of the Commercial Operational Regulatory and Compliance environment in South Africa.
    • A strong desire to drive the commercial growth and strategic plans of the South African business.
    • Exceptional interpersonal and communication skills both written and verbal in English.
    • Have held a senior commercial operations and P&L leadership role in South Africas gambling sector for 3 years.
    • Ability to build rapport and get the best out of external partners intrinsic to the success of the South African business.
    • Budget management proficiency with analytical skills to assess marketing opportunities and forecast and identify trends.
    • Strong presentation skills and ability to convey strategic plans across different levels of the organisation.
    • Experience of working with external thirdparty suppliers is preferable.
    • Experience of working within a global company and matrix organisation is preferable.
    • Strong negotiation and relationshipbuilding skills.
    • Ability to work under pressure and manage multiple projects simultaneously.
    • High level of attention to detail and organisational skills.
